How do you get extra experience?

i am playing the game in normal mode.
when i level up , i get 2 ability points and 3 skill points.
when i check the goods of marchant, i found many weapon or armor which require high ability , such as STR179 or DEX200, that i can't answer (i can buy it but can't equip it ).
my base ability point is 50/50/50 in the game starting, it takes a long time to level up and get enough ability point for equiping some heavy weapon.

how do you get more experience for leveling up quickly ?

There is no way to level up quick-like. The best you can do is farm like hell (farm = fight every enemy in the area, save/exit, load again and do the same).

Not quite exactly the same xp, it's going to be less every level up.

Killing the skeletons that spawns from the Death Obelisk (spelling?) is a nice constant and booooring way to get xp if you can manage them.

Don't forget that the masteries add a good amount of stats, so maybe you wanna spend some extra points on your current mastery.

Also look for rings and amulets with +%STR / DEX / INT. My Harbinger had 10xx str at lvl 30ish because such rings and amulets.

Quote:
Not quite exactly the same xp, it's going to be less every level up.
In TQIT, all hero monsters give the exact same amount of XP each time, even if your significantly higher level than when you last fought it. I remember fighting Typhon at 23rd level and 26th level and getting 10,550 each time.

Don't worry about the max, is far over to one million (about 100.000.000, don't remember exactly).

The highest character level is 65 (TQ) and 75 (TQ: IT).
